On your Fugent Dashboard, select Menu > Scheduling Assistant
Select, "Create Schedule".
The next screen will allow you to customize your new schedule:
Refer to the steps below for each section outlined and titled in red above.
A. Schedule Name
Customizing the name of your schedule allows you to easily identify what the schedule is intended for if you have multiple availabilities. This can be a unique name given to a:
- Group of Contacts
- Geographical Region
- Time Period Available
(Optional) Including a Schedule Description - Selecting, "YES", the description entered will be visibly displayed for your audience on your Scheduling Assistant page.
B. What Types of Meetings Would you like Visitors to Request?
There are three available options for meeting requestors (In-Person, Web Meeting, Phone Only) . Select all that apply for this particular schedule you are creating.
C. What Durations are Visitors Allowed to Choose?
Multiple meeting time durations are made available to the requestor. You can customize which durations are available to meeting requestors for this particular schedule you are creating.
D. Do you want to create a Lead Time/Wrap Time for Meeting Requests?
A lead time allows for a customizable buffer time between the current time and the next available time slot on your schedule. Choosing an appropriate lead time discourages last minute scheduling.
Example: If the current time is 9:15 AM. With a lead time of one hour chosen, My next available appointment would be 10:15 AM.
A wrap time allows for a buffer time after your meetings scheduled within Fugent. Typically, wrap times are used for entering notes about the meeting you hosted and/or prep for the next meeting.
Example: your scheduled meeting ends at 11:30 AM, a wrap time of 30 minutes chosen will display 12:00 PM as your next available meeting in your schedule.
G. Do you want to set a default meeting location for in-person appointments?
NOTE: If "In Person" appointments selected above in section "B." this field will appear pictured below.
If you want to set a standard meeting location for In Person meetings, you can enter the address information here.
H. Allow Booking
If you want to limit how long you are looking to allow the booking, you can select three options below.
This section defaults with a 90 day window of rolling availability. Requestors will not have access into your calendar past that 90th day. This option can be further customized with a shorter or longer number of days.
"Date Range" will only show availability between two dates.
Selecting, "Forever" will have no parameters around your future availability.
I. Set Available Times
The section pictured above will allow you to customize the available times/dates for each day of the week. All times are associated with your selected default time zone when creating your account.
Select a date on the calendar to further customize each selected day available. The below module will appear when a date is selected on the monthly calendar view.
A. Are You Available on the selected date?
Depending on the initial date chosen, are you available/unavailable for appointments for the date selected.
B. Time Intervals
Time intervals can be entered in this field. The"+Add Time Interval" will allow you to add multiple time blocks into your schedule.
C. Meeting Increments Displayed
You can select between a 15, 30 or 60 Minute time blocks to be displayed.
D. When would you like to apply this selected availability
Depending on the options selected above, you can choose to:
1. "Only On..." - Applies only on the initial date selected
2. "On Repeating Days" - Applies only on selected days of the week
3. "On Specific Days" - Applies availability on custom dates
Select, "Apply" to save the updated information. You'll notice that the monthly calendar will update with your new available dates/times you've applied.
Email Settings for Appointment Requests
The Email Settings section allows you to send automatic meeting reminders to the meeting requestor. These can be sent between an hour and a week in advance.
Depending on the permissions you are granted in your Fugent account, you will only have one email template available for meeting reminder emails.
Select, "Save Settings" to update and save your new schedule.
